Facts Summary:
Orthochromis is a genus of fishes of concern and found in the following area(s): Burundi, Tanzania.

Scientific Name | Status | Listing Date | Range | |
1. | Orthochromis kasuluensis | EN-IUCN | 2006 | Tanzania |
2. | Orthochromis luichensis | VU-IUCN | 2006 | Tanzania |
3. | Orthochromis malagaraziensis | VU-IUCN | 2006 | Burundi, Tanzania |
4. | Orthochromis mazimeroensis | EN-IUCN | 2006 | Burundi, Tanzania |
5. | Orthochromis mosoensis | EN-IUCN | 2006 | Burundi, Tanzania |
6. | Orthochromis rubrolabialis | EN-IUCN | 2006 | Tanzania |
7. | Orthochromis rugufuensis | VU-IUCN | 2006 | Tanzania |
8. | Orthochromis uvinzae | CR-IUCN | 2006 | Tanzania |
